What Are Single and Double Basin Sinks?
Single Basin Sink: Features one large, continuous bowl. It’s usually deeper and wider than a divided sink.
Double Basin Sink: Consists of two separate compartments – either equally sized or with an offset configuration (e.g., 60/40 or 70/30).

Pros and Cons of a Single Basin Sink
Pros:
More space for washing large items like pots, baking trays, and pans.
Easier to clean – no divider to scrub around.
Ideal for smaller kitchens with limited countertop space.
Cons:
Less flexibility for multitasking (e.g., washing and rinsing at the same time).
If you don’t have a dishwasher, it might be less convenient for handling many dishes.
Pros and Cons of a Double Basin Sink
Pros:
Better organization: one side can be used for washing, the other for rinsing or holding dirty dishes.
Great for households without a dishwasher.
One basin can be used for soaking or thawing food without interfering with other tasks.
Cons:
Less space in each compartment – might be difficult to wash large cookware.
Takes up more countertop space.
More difficult to clean due to the central divider.
There’s no one-size-fits-all answer – the right kitchen sink depends entirely on your habits and lifestyle. Single basin sinks offer more space and are ideal for modern kitchens with automated appliances, while double basin sinks provide flexibility and better organization for more traditional or hands-on cooking environments.
